WordPressウェブサイトの作成には無限の可能性がありますが、特定のコンテンツを制限する必要がある場合もあります。会員制サイトを、クライアントのプロジェクトを準備する場合でも、あるいは特定のユーザーに限定リソースを共有する場合でも、WordPressでパスワード保護されたページは、簡単かつ効果的なソリューションとなります。
しかし、どうすれば適切なユーザーだけがコンテンツを閲覧できるようにできるでしょうか?WordPressなら、複雑なコードや高度な技術知識を必要とせずに、個々の投稿、ページ、さらにはサイト全体を保護できます。このガイドでは、WordPressページにパスワード保護を設定する理由、方法、そしてベストプラクティスを詳しく説明します。組み込みエディタの使い方から、強力なWordPressプラグインや高度なセキュリティ対策まで、様々な方法をご紹介します。
貴重なコンテンツへのアクセスを簡単に制御する方法を見てみましょう。.
WordPress でページをパスワード保護する理由

方法に入る前に、パスワード保護がなぜ有益であるかを検討してみましょう。.
- コンテンツのプライバシー: レポート、下書き、クライアントの成果物などの機密情報へのアクセスを制限するのに最適です。
- 限定アクセス: プレミアム コンテンツ、ゲート リソース、または購読者専用のページを提供するサイトに最適です。
- SEO コントロール検索エンジンによってコンテンツがインデックスされるタイミングと方法を管理できます。下書きや作業中のページに最適です。
- コラボレーションとフィードバック: 作業を公開せずにクライアントやチーム メンバーと安全に共有します。
複数のアクセス レベルを備えた高度なパスワード保護が必要ですか?
当社の WordPress エキスパートは、高度なパスワード保護、ロールベースのアクセスなどを設定し、完全に安全なエクスペリエンスを実現するお手伝いをいたします。.
方法1:WordPressの組み込み機能を使用してページをパスワード保護する方法

WordPressには、個々のページや投稿を保護するのに最適なパスワード保護機能が組み込まれています。この方法は簡単で、追加のプラグインは必要ありません。.
ステップバイステップガイド
- WordPress ダッシュボードにログインします。
管理者アカウントでログインし、必要な権限があることを確認します。 - 保護するページ/投稿に移動します。
サイドバーで、 [投稿] > [すべての投稿または[ページ] > [すべてのページ、保護する特定のページまたは投稿を見つけます。 - 表示設定を編集する
- [編集]をクリックして投稿エディタを開きます。
- 公開を見つけて、/非表示。
- オプションから「パスワード保護」を選択します
- パスワードを設定して保存する
安全なパスワード(最大20文字)を入力してください。不正アクセスを防ぐのに十分な強度と、固有のパスワードを設定してください。 - ページを公開または更新する
- 新しいページの場合は、 「公開」。
- 既存のページの場合は、 「更新」変更を保存します。
注意:このページにアクセスしようとする訪問者は、コンテンツを表示するためにパスワードを入力するよう求められます。
読む: WordPress のパスワードリセットページをカスタマイズする方法?
方法2:WordPressプラグインを使用して複数のページをパスワード保護する

Protect WordPress (PPWP)などのプラグインの使い方をご紹介します。
パスワード保護WordPress(PPWP)プラグインの使用
PPWPプラグインは、サイト全体の保護、複数のパスワード設定、さらには部分的なコンテンツ制限など、高度な保護オプションを提供します。
- プラグインをインストールして有効化する
- ダッシュボードから、 「プラグイン>新規追加」。
- 「PPWP」を検索してプラグインをインストールし、 「アクティブ化」。
- サイト全体の保護を設定する
- サイドバーで、 「Password Protect WordPress」、 「Sitewide Protection」。
- 「サイト全体をパスワードで保護」トグルを有効にして、Web サイト全体のパスワードを作成します。
- 設定のカスタマイズ
PPWP を使用すると、ユーザー ロールに基づいてアクセスを制限したり、パスワード メモリの Cookie 有効期限を設定したり、特定の IP アドレスがパスワード プロンプトをバイパスできるようにしたりするなどの追加設定を構成できます。 - 変更を保存してテストする
保護を設定したら、シークレットウィンドウでサイトにアクセスして機能をテストしてください。サイト全体でパスワードプロンプトが表示されるはずです。
方法3: HTTP認証による高度なセキュリティ

さらなるセキュリティを求める方には、HTTP認証が優れたサーバー側オプションです。多くのホスティングプロバイダーはHTTP認証をサポートしており、ページが読み込まれる前に不正アクセスをブロックします。
ホスティングプロバイダーでHTTP認証を設定する
- .htaccess ファイルにアクセスする
- ホストが cPanel をサポートしている場合は、ファイル マネージャー.htaccessを見つけます。
- ホストが直接アクセスを提供しない場合は、サポート チームに問い合わせて支援を受けてください。.
- .htaccess に認証コードを追加する
.htaccessに次の行を挿入します。
AuthType Basic AuthName "制限されたコンテンツ" AuthUserFile /path/to/.htpasswd 有効なユーザーが必要
- .htpasswd ファイルを生成する
- オンライン ツールを使用して、.htpasswd ファイルのハッシュ パスワードを生成します。.
- .htpasswd ファイルを非公開ディレクトリに配置します。.
注意: 認証資格情報を持たない訪問者はサイトにアクセスできません。
詳細: WordPress サイトをマルウェアから保護するには?
パスワード保護に役立つその他のプラグイン
セキュリティを強化し、アクセスをより細かく制御するために、これらの WordPress プラグインは、さまざまなサイトのニーズに合わせて調整された多用途のパスワード保護オプションを提供します。.
パススター

Passster は、ショートコードを使用してコンテンツのセクションをパスワードで保護したり、サイト全体に保護を適用したり、アクセスを延長するために Cookie を設定したりできる多目的プラグインです。
特徴:
- 部分的なページ保護。.
- カスタマイズ可能なパスワードプロンプト。.
- ユーザーの利便性を考慮した Cookie の有効期限設定。.
パスワード保護されたカテゴリ

WooCommerce ストアやメンバーシップ サイトに最適なPassword Protected Categories プラグインを特定のカテゴリのコンテンツをパスワードで保護できます。
特徴:
- 製品カテゴリまたはメンバーコンテンツを制限します。.
- WooCommerce と互換性があります。.
- 複数レベルのアクセス制御を可能にします。.
シンプルなメンバーシッププラグイン

Simple Membershipプラグインは、メンバーシップアクセスを管理するために設計されており、コンテンツへのアクセスレベルが異なるサイトに最適です。パスワード保護されたページを作成し、無料または有料のメンバーシップを簡単に提供できます。
特徴:
- メンバーシップレベルに基づいてコンテンツを制限します。.
- 有料コンテンツの支払いゲートウェイと統合します
- 詳細なアクセス制御とコンテンツの可視性設定を提供します。.
SEO とユーザー エクスペリエンス (UX) のためのパスワード保護の管理
WordPressでページをパスワード保護するとSEOに影響を及ぼす可能性があります。セキュリティと検索性のバランスを取るために考慮すべき点をご紹介します。.
SEOインパクト
- パスワードで保護されたページ: 検索エンジンはパスワードを必要とするコンテンツをインデックス化しないため、パスワード保護は戦略的に使用してください。
- Noindex メタタグ: 非公開コンテンツの場合は、検索エンジンがこれらのページをクロールしないように noindex タグを追加します。
ユーザーエクスペリエンス
- 明確なコミュニケーション: 混乱を避けるために、パスワードを入力する必要がある理由を訪問者に伝えます。
- パスワードの強度: 簡単に推測されないように、一意かつ強力なパスワードを推奨します。
検索:サイトのセキュリティを強化: WordPress 2要素認証を導入する簡単な手順
パスワード保護の長所と短所
パスワード保護は便利ですが、いくつかのトレードオフが伴います。.
長所
- 簡単に実装できます: 組み込みの機能とプラグインによりセットアップが簡単になります。
- 柔軟なアクセス: 特定のコンテンツにアクセスできるユーザーを制御します。
- コーディング不要:初心者でも簡単にアクセスできます。
短所
- 制限された SEO 可視性: パスワードで保護されたページは検索エンジンに表示されません。
- 基本的なセキュリティ: パスワードだけでは、あらゆる種類の不正アクセスを防ぐことはできません。
詳細は: WordPressがハッキングされた?ハッキングされたWordPressサイトを修復する方法
パスワード保護のベストプラクティス
パスワードで保護されたページが確実に安全であることを保証するには、次のベスト プラクティスに従ってください。.
強力なパスワードを使用する:推測しやすいフレーズは避け、大文字、小文字、数字、記号を組み合わせて強力なパスワードを作成します。
定期的に更新する:特に機密性の高いコンテンツや頻繁にアクセスするコンテンツについては、パスワードを定期的に変更するスケジュールを設定して、不正アクセスのリスクを軽減します。
共有アクセスを制限する:パスワードは信頼できる個人とのみ共有し、アクセス レベルを制御するためにページごとに固有のパスワードを検討します。
これらの手順に従うことで、WordPress ページを安全に保ち、サイトのコンテンツのプライバシーを維持するのに役立ちます。.
WordPressのページ/サイトにおけるパスワード保護に関する最終的な考察
WordPressのパスワード保護は、複雑なセキュリティソリューションを必要とせずにコンテンツを保護するための強力な手段です。クライアントのドキュメントを保護する場合、限定コンテンツを公開する場合、あるいは将来のリリースに向けてページを準備する場合など、WordPressなら簡単にページのパスワード保護が可能です。基本的なニーズには組み込みエディタを使い始めるか、高度な制御と柔軟性を求める場合は高度なプラグインをご検討ください。.
WordPress サイトを安全にする準備はできていますか?今すぐパスワード保護を実装して第一歩を踏み出し、より詳細なセキュリティ対策については WordPress セキュリティ チェックリスト
WordPressでページをパスワード保護する: FAQ
WordPress の組み込み機能とプラグインの違いは何ですか?
組み込みの WordPress 機能は単一ページの保護に限定されていますが、PPWP や Passster などのプラグインは、サイト全体の保護、部分的なコンテンツ制限、ユーザー ロール固有のパスワードなどの高度なオプションを提供します。.
ページをパスワード保護すると SEO に影響しますか?
はい、検索エンジンはパスワードで保護されたページをクロールしません。SEOが不可欠な場合は、重要な情報を公開したままにするために、部分的なコンテンツ保護を提供するプラグインの使用を検討してください。.
1 つのページに複数のパスワードを使用できますか?
WordPress はこれをネイティブでサポートしていませんが、PPWP などのプラグインを使用すると、複数のパスワードを設定したり、ユーザーの役割に基づいてアクセスを制限したりできます。.
.